Tar Heels In NBA: Danny Green Returns From Knee Injury
Posted Feb 2, 2023
After a knee injury during last season’s NBA playoffs that many thought would end his career, Danny Green finally made his season debut Wednesday night after a long rehabilitation process. After an offseason trade from Philadelphia to the Memphis Grizzlies, Green, 35, entered the game to start the second quarter of their 122-112 home loss to Portland.
